1 / 7

Sharing is Caring In Datacenter Networks

Sharing is Caring In Datacenter Networks. A cloud computing discussion led by Justine. Techniques we learned today. Random can work “pretty well” (VLB/ECMP) to avoid collisions in DC networks.

derron
Download Presentation

Sharing is Caring In Datacenter Networks

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Sharing is Caring In Datacenter Networks A cloud computing discussion led by Justine

  2. Techniques we learned today • Random can work “pretty well” (VLB/ECMP) to avoid collisions in DC networks. • For bulk computing applications like Dryad and MR, optimizing transfers rather than flowsmakes jobs run much faster. • Using a centralized controller • To schedule (Orchestra) • To route and reroute (Hedera) …can improve performance.

  3. But let’s be careful about when they’re useful… • Bulk computing frameworks • Flows are large • Flows come in batches - transfers • Can typically modify endpoints • Front-end/Web Services • Flows are small • Flows arise on-demand • Want flows to complete as quickly as possible

  4. But let’s be careful about when they’re useful… • And what about multi-tenant environments, e.g. EC2? • Traffic patterns are varied • Fairness very important • Limited or no ability to change end-host stack

  5. What’s missing from the centralized schedulers in Hedera and Orchestra?

  6. None of these papers focused on network topology – is topology even relevant?

  7. Obligatory WIN/LOSE Table

More Related